Many of us like to consider a bitcoin investment journey as 4-10 years or longer, and sure it is important to consider if we are able to commit to 4-10 years or longer, yet we still could get started in bitcoin without making such a commitment to 4-10 years or longer, but tentatively be considering that we may well be able to commit to 4-10 years or longer at some later point down the road.

Another thing is to figure out what our bitcoin position size might be, and surely it could make a difference if we are being aggressive in our bitcoin investment orif we are being whimpy, which also gets back to potentially sorting out various aspects of ourselves and our cashflows so that we might be able to better determine the extent that we are even able to get aggressive in our bitcoin investment approach, versus if we might have other investments that we might be considering to involve ourself in as well. 

There are 9 individual factors that can be considered in the context of investing into bitcoin, whether we are newbie investors or if we maybe have been investing into bitcoin for a whole cycle or more.

I personally believe that it is not important for any new investor to invest into anything other than bitcoin when they are just getting started investing, so they might well start out with only having investments of bitcoin and cash, and then they can perhaps work out their bitcoin accumulation path from there and at some point down the road figure out if they might choose to diversify into other assets beyone bitcoin and cash.
